## Migration Step 4 — Rebuild the Bloom Filter

After upgrading the Cravenmoor key-value store, the bloom filter that fronts it must be rebuilt, since the old filter's hash seeds are incompatible with the new key encoding. Run the rebuild job during a quiet window; lookups will temporarily fall through to the store, raising load but not breaking reads. Support should expect slower responses for about twenty minutes. The rebuild job reads its seed configuration from the metadata database, which you can reach with the connection string below.

primary connection of tajeg-tajop = postgresql://julax_svc:DI@db-e7f3.kelvidyn.corp:5432/rusdor

# Hey plugin folks! This env file powers GiftLeaf, the donation-receipt
# mailer behind the Orchardwell Fund's giving portal. Your plugin hooks
# into the receipt pipeline after PDF render but before dispatch, so
# keep handlers fast — anything over 2s gets skipped. Locale overrides
# live in receipts.toml, not here. Templates hot-reload in dev mode,
# which is handy. One thing you do need from this file: the signing
# secret the mailer uses to stamp each receipt. Here it is:

sealed setting: ARCHIVE_KEY3=8d0

Ticket: Staging env misconfigured for checkout load tests

Hey, welcome aboard! Quick one before you kick off the Lumabright checkout load tests: staging is currently pointed at the sandbox payment stub, which rate-limits hard after 50 requests, so your numbers will look terrible. Flip the CHECKOUT_GATEWAY_MODE flag to "loadtest" in the staging .env, then restart the cart workers. You'll also need the gateway's signing secret so requests aren't rejected. Add this line right after the mode flag:

secret setting of yajog-taguf: ARCHIVE_KEY3=051

Management Meeting Minutes — Torvane Group

Quick recap for sales leads: leadership confirmed a hiring freeze in the Brightmere Logistics division through end of quarter. Open reqs are paused, not cancelled. Existing offers will be honoured. Sales headcount is unaffected, so keep pipelines moving. Priya from ops will field questions at Friday's standup. The rationale and next steps are summarised in the confidential note below.

board note of fahif-yahog: Gross margin on Wenath came in at 10 percent against a plan of 5 percent. Only 3 of the 100 pilot accounts renewed Wenath, so a churn review is set for July 15.